HIP 49950

HIP 49950 is a star cataloged in modern stellar databases.

At a distance of roughly 2,297 light-years, HIP 49950 is a distant star lying deep within the Milky Way galaxy.

HIP 49950 has an apparent magnitude of +6.68, placing it beyond naked-eye visibility. A good pair of binoculars or a small telescope is required to observe this star. Observers will note its red h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+2.269.
